On February 7, SC Freiburg are hosting Werder Bremen in the Bundesliga of Germany, with kickoff at 14:30 UTC.
The countdown begins for a clash that promises intensity as the upcoming match sees Freiburg and Werder Bremen renew their battle, 5 months after the previous Bundesliga encounter which Freiburg won 0-3. With losses to Stuttgart and Lille, Freiburg's form has dipped ahead of this clash. Strengthening their defense will be critical to turning their fortunes around, since their backline has lacked consistency, with goals conceded across three consecutive matches.
Werder Bremen come into this encounter after splitting points with Borussia Monchengladbach yesterday. Their defense has shown cracks, with goals conceded across five consecutive matches.
In this Bundesliga showdown, the spotlight will fall on the players who have been pivotal for SC Freiburg and Werder Bremen throughout the campaign. Freiburg’s offensive unit, carefully orchestrated by Julian Schuster, has leaned on Vincenzo Grifo, their main scorer, and Yuito Suzuki, as they continue to drive the team’s attacking efforts forward. Freiburg’s top scorer in Bundesliga, Grifo, has six goals this season, while Suzuki has been their leading creator in the competition with three assists. Supporting them are Igor Matanovic, Derry Scherhant and Johan Manzambi, who have also chipped in with important goals and assists, adding depth to Freiburg’s attack.
Meanwhile, Romano Schmid and Jens Stage have been pivotal for Werder Bremen’s attack, under Horst Steffen’s guidance, combining to deliver important goals and assists. With six goals in Bundesliga, Stage is Werder Bremen’s top scorer in the league, while Schmid has been their leading creator in the competition with five assists. Werder Bremen have also relied on Samuel Mbangula, Justin Njinmah and Yukinari Sugawara to energize their attack through key shots and passes.

Since April 2023, the teams have clashed six times. SC Freiburg claimed victory five times while Werder Bremen once. The most recent match between them was on September 20, 2025, in the Bundesliga of Germany, where Freiburg secured a 0-3 victory. In total, Freiburg have managed thirteen goals in these six meetings, compared to Werder Bremen's four. Overall, SC Freiburg hold a stronger head-to-head record against Werder Bremen in recent meetings.
This season in Bundesliga, SC Freiburg have recorded seven wins, six draws, and six losses in nineteen matches, netting 31 goals (1.63 per match) and conceding 32 (1.68 per match). This season in Bundesliga, Werder Bremen have recorded four wins, seven draws, and nine losses in twenty matches, scoring 22 goals, averaging 1.10 per match, while conceding 38, an average of 1.90 per match.
SC Freiburg are in the middle of a two-match losing streak, with defeats against Stuttgart and Lille in their last two matches, while Werder Bremen’s previous game resulted in a draw against Borussia Monchengladbach.. Overall, over their most recent twenty games, Freiburg have claimed ten victories, suffered five defeats, and drawn five times, while Werder Bremen have won four of their last twenty matches, losing eight and drawing eight.
As always, Germany Bundesliga's live standings are availble and updated in real time. SC Freiburg are currently 7th in the table with 27 points from nineteen matches, while Werder Bremen occupy 15th spot with nineteen points in twenty matches.
